I had some Terramyacin ointment which I applied on Friday late afternoon. I got home today and his eye looks a little better. It is open but appears to be bloodshot. Do you think he stuck something in it? I have been keeping his enclosure at 70-80% humidity. He ate a great diet over the summer so I really don't think it is a Vitamin A deficiency. He doesn't appear to have a respiratory infection either. He has been refusing to eat as he is slowing for hibernation. I am concerned as he MUST be allowed to hibernate as I had to last year after not eating for many weeks.
